Common Paint Problems Homeowners Encounter
Many homeowners encounter various challenges when it comes to decorating their rooms. One ongoing problem is choosing the appropriate color; with countless shades available, many find it hard to imagine how a color will appear in their home. Surface preparation is another essential obstacle; insufficient washing or priming can lead to flaking and uneven coatings. Additionally, homeowners often misjudge the quantity of paint needed, causing several trips to the shop or excess remaining paint. What Should You Know About the Painting Process?
Learning about the painting procedure can help alleviate some of the frustrations property owners face during their projects. The journey typically begins with a meeting, where professionals assess the space and talk about paint colors. Following this, the team readies the area by moving furniture, covering surfaces, and fixing any damage to the wall surfaces. Priming may take place, especially for new or repaired surfaces, ensuring improved paint bonding.
When preparations are accomplished, painters spread the chosen paint using appropriate techniques for a smooth finish. Homeowners can expect a multi-layer application for excellent color depth and durability. Communication throughout the process is vital; painters often provide updates and manage any concerns. Finally, the project concludes with a thorough clean-up, returning the space to its original state. Understanding these steps can equip homeowners, setting realistic expectations for a effective painting experience.

Essential Paint Application Methods for a Flawless Result
To achieve a immaculate finish in house painting, one must master fundamental techniques that raise the overall standard of the work. Proper surface preparation is critical, including thorough cleaning, sanding, and priming to guarantee the paint adheres properly. This process avoids problems like peeling and bubbling in the future.
Selecting premium painting tools significantly affects the final appearance; the right equipment minimize streaks and guarantee uniform coverage. Applying a methodical method, including painting in sections and maintaining a wet edge, helps prevent visible lines and imperfections.
Additionally, putting on multiple light coats rather than a single thick layer increases durability and vibrancy of color. Attention to detail, especially when cutting in around edges and trim, additionally contributes to a clean look. By employing these approaches, homeowners can achieve a striking finish that transforms their space and displays the expertise of professional painters.
Picking the Right Hues for Your Home
How might property owners determine the perfect colors for their living spaces? A thoughtful approach involves recognizing the mood and atmosphere they aim to create. Warm colors, like reds and oranges, can energize spaces, while cool colors such as blues, greens, and cool variations promote peace. Assessing the ambient light in each room is important; shades can appear different contingent upon the light's intensity and direction.
Homeowners should also think about existing furnishings and decor, ensuring a harmonious look throughout the home. Using color samples or samples can help visualize how selected shades will interact with the overall environment. Additionally, exploring color principles can provide insights into complementary and contrasting colors, enhancing aesthetic appeal.
Ultimately, personal preferences should inform decisions, as the chosen palette will convey the homeowner's personal style and identity. By combining these components, selecting ideal hues becomes a fulfilling and delightful journey.
Tips for Maintaining Your Freshly Painted Surfaces
Safeguarding newly coated surfaces in great condition requires vigilant attention to make certain they remain vibrant and intact. Consistent cleaning is paramount; using a soft cloth and gentle detergent can help clear away grime and marks without harming the coating material. It is best to avoid abrasive cleaners that may scratch or dull the finish.
In addition, property owners should look for damage signals, such as fading and peeling, and tackle these concerns promptly to block continued deterioration. Adding a protective sealant can strengthen durability, especially in busy areas.
Temperature and moisture content also contribute to maintaining painted surfaces in good condition; keeping indoor environments stable can reduce fluctuations that harm the paint. Finally, it is beneficial to prevent subjecting painted surfaces to direct sunlight for extended periods, as UV rays can cause colors to fade. By following these tips, individuals can enjoy their freshly painted spaces for many years.

How Much Time Will Your Paint Stay Good Before Needing a Touch up?
Typically, high-quality paint lasts between five to seven years before demanding touch-ups. Factors such as climate factors, foundation work, and paint formula can impact durability, influencing how soon repairs might be necessary.
Is It Feasible to Stay in My Home During the Painting Process?
Yes, property owners can usually remain in their living spaces during the painting work. However, it's advisable to avoid newly painted areas to steer clear of fumes and enable the paint to cure properly for optimal performance.
Which Variety of Paint Performs Best in High-Moisture Locations?
In damp areas including bathrooms and kitchens, selecting acrylic or latex paint with mold prevention is wise. These paints offer endurance, hassle-free cleaning, and stop mold growth, securing persistent performance in humid areas.
Are Green Paints On the Market for Residential Purposes?
Certainly, eco-friendly finishes are on the market for domestic purposes. These paints, frequently labeled as low-VOC or zero-VOC, lessen harmful emissions and are created from natural ingredients, delivering better choices for both dwellers and the environment.
What Ways Do Seasonal Shifts Affect Painting Undertakings?
Seasonal fluctuations greatly influence painting projects, as temperature and humidity levels impact paint attachment and drying times. Spring and fall offer ideal conditions, while extreme heat or cold can produce poor results and prolonged project durations.
